Futuristic offshore industrial platform, complex design.
Keywords
industrial,
platform,
refinery,
offshore,
structure,
technology,
energy,
futuristic,
complex,
machinery,
pipe,
metal,
steel,
construction,
engineering,
design,
modern,
equipment,
industrial design,
manufacturing,
power,
system,
processing,
fabrication,
architecture,
technically,
installation,
apparatus,
facility,
plant